Purdue's Board of Trustees decided Wednesday morning to give President Mitch Daniels $110,880 in performance pay, or 88 percent of the total possible $126,000 he could have earned.

The amount depended on how the trustees sized up his ability to reach certain goals in key areas.

Mike Berghoff, chairman of the trustees' compensation committee, said Daniels came closest to meeting goals of increasing graduation rates and reducing student debt.

But Berghoff said the one area where Daniels fell short was fundraising.

Daniels is traveling in India and was not immediately available for comment.
